Taneytown is filled with culture and history for residents to explore. The Taneytown History Museum is free and open to the public Fridays, Saturdays, and Sundays. The museum features artifacts and exhibits displaying the rich history of the town. You can also stop by the gift shop inside the museum. Another historic area of town is the Bullfrog Road Bridge, which has been added to the National Register of Historic Places. The one lane bridge extends over the Monocacy River and was initially built in 1908.
For some outdoor fun, the town hosts the annual Family Fun Days each August. The festival lasts two days and features a barrel train ride for kids, a dunk tank, local food booths, face painting, music, a car show, local dance performances, a petting zoo, and pony rides. The festival also includes stargazing, complete with telescopes from the Westminster Astronomical Society. The town offers youth sports, including football, soccer, field hockey, lacrosse, basketball, and softball. For some relaxation, the town offers six parks. One of the local parks, Roberts Mill Park, offers beautiful views of a natural spring-fed pond. The park is nearly 20 acres and offers benches and lush grass for picnics. You can also find lighted soccer fields, a full basketball court, a fenced in playground, a sand volleyball court, and a lighted walking trail around the pond. You can take a break on one of the benches near the shore and observe the wildlife that calls the park home.
